How Old Was Jesus When the Magi Came? A Look at the Nativity Narrative
The question of Jesus's age when the Magi, often called the Wise Men, visited him is a fascinating one, prompting much discussion among biblical scholars and theologians. While the Bible doesn't explicitly state Jesus's age, we can glean insights from the narrative to form a reasonable estimation. This article will explore the various perspectives and arrive at a plausible conclusion.
The biblical account of the Magi's visit is found in Matthew 2. The passage describes them arriving in Bethlehem, guided by a star, to worship the newborn King of the Jews. This implies Jesus was very young, likely still an infant. Several clues within the narrative point towards a specific timeframe.
Clues from the Nativity Narrative
- "Baby" in a "Manger": The Gospel of Luke (2:7) describes Jesus being laid in a manger, indicating he was a newborn. This aligns with the understanding that the Magi's visit occurred shortly after Jesus's birth.
- Herod's Massacre of the Innocents: Following the Magi's visit, Herod, fearing a rival king, orders the massacre of all male infants in Bethlehem and its vicinity (Matthew 2:16-18). This further suggests Jesus was very young, perhaps under two years old, as Herod's decree targeted infants, not older children.
- The Star of Bethlehem: The description of a star guiding the Magi implies a specific astronomical event, although the exact nature of this star remains a matter of debate among astronomers and biblical scholars. Regardless, the timing of such an event would have been significant in pinpointing the timeframe.
Possible Age Ranges:
Based on these clues, most biblical scholars place Jesus's age at between a few weeks and two years old when the Magi visited. The precise age remains unknown and open to interpretation. It's unlikely he was older than two, given Herod's decree targeting infants.
Why the Uncertainty?
The lack of explicit mention of Jesus's age is intentional. The narrative focuses on the theological significance of the event—the adoration of the Christ child by Gentiles, representing the universal appeal of Christianity. The precise age is secondary to the spiritual message.
Conclusion: A Young Jesus
In summary, while we cannot pinpoint Jesus's exact age during the Magi's visit, the biblical account strongly suggests he was a very young child, most likely under two years old. This interpretation aligns with the context of the nativity story, Herod's actions, and the general understanding of the event as the adoration of a newborn king. The exact age remains a matter of theological discussion but within a fairly narrow timeframe. The focus remains firmly on the spiritual significance of the visit, a testament to the divinity and importance of Jesus Christ.
